I had my battery installed just over a month ago using a 4G dongle (there were no WiFi ones available). This only worked intermittently (assumed due to poor signal), but I was seeing some data on the portal every day and could change the inverter settings when it was online.

A few days ago I was sent a WiFi dongle. I have fitted this and got it connected to my WiFi. I can now see live data from the inverter via the app, but there is no cloud data and I can't update the inverter settings via the app.

Does the installer need to do something to get the dongle communicating correctly or should it just work?

Thanks for the reply. Yes, I'm getting no results from the desktop at https://www.givenergy.cloud/login. The Wi-Fi serial number on the inverter page still shows the serial number of the 4G dongle so this clearly needs changing. I have asked the installer to look into it.

Installer needs to login as Engineer, go you your account and delete Dongle. Then Add the Serial of the new one
